While some areas of the state were waterlogged last week, farmers had 5.1 days suitable for fieldwork which included cutting hay and planting cover crops. According to this week’s crop progress report from the U.S. Department of Agriculture, Iowa’s corn is rated at 13% fair, 59% good and 24% excellent. In southeast Iowa, 70% of corn has dented and 21% is mature, ahead of this time last year when only eight percent of corn locally was mature.
